May 17, 2024: Yankees 4 – White Sox 2
The Yankees secured a solid 4-2 victory over the White Sox on this date. The game saw impressive performances from both hitters and pitchers.
Key Player Stats
- Aaron Judge: 1 home run, 2 RBIs, .315 batting average
- Giancarlo Stanton: 1 home run, 1 RBI, .278 batting average
- Nestor Cortes: 6 innings pitched, 7 strikeouts, 2 earned runs
- White Sox’s Luis Robert Jr.: 2-for-4, 1 RBI, .305 batting average
- Dylan Cease: 5.2 innings pitched, 6 strikeouts, 3 earned runs
The Yankees capitalized on home runs from Judge and Stanton, while Cortes held off the White Sox’s offensive threats. Robert Jr. was the standout for Chicago but couldn’t propel his team to victory.
May 18, 2024: Yankees 6 – White Sox 1
The Yankees dominated the White Sox with a strong 6-1 win, showcasing both their batting power and pitching precision.
Key Player Stats
- Juan Soto: 2 home runs, 4 RBIs, .320 batting average
- Gleyber Torres: 3-for-4, 1 RBI, .290 batting average
- Luis Gil: 7 innings pitched, 14 strikeouts, 1 earned run
- Andrew Benintendi (White Sox): 1-for-3, 1 RBI, .295 batting average
- Michael Kopech: 4 innings pitched, 5 strikeouts, 4 earned runs
Juan Soto had a phenomenal game with two home runs, while Luis Gil struck out 14 batters, marking a career-high. The White Sox struggled offensively, with Benintendi providing their only run.
August 12, 2024: White Sox 12 – Yankees 2
In a shocking turn of events, the White Sox crushed the Yankees 12-2, showcasing their offensive firepower.
Key Player Stats
- Gavin Sheets: 4-for-5, 4 RBIs, .298 batting average
- Korey Lee: 2-for-4, 1 home run, 3 RBIs
- Brooks Baldwin: 1 home run, 2 RBIs
- Yankees’ Carlos Rodon: 3 innings pitched, 6 earned runs, 4 strikeouts
- White Sox’s Touki Toussaint: 6 innings pitched, 7 strikeouts, 2 earned runs
The White Sox dominated this game with an explosive offense. Sheets delivered a career-high four hits, while Korey Lee and Brooks Baldwin both homered. The Yankees struggled, with Rodon giving up six earned runs early on.
